Zou Wenjun, Dean of School of Materials Science and Engineering, Henan University of Technology
In the morning, I listened to the analysis report of Deputy Secretary-General Chen Yuandong on the operation of the industry in 2015. I feel that the situation of our coated abrasive industry is relatively good. It is understood that many industries in China have fallen by an average of 10-15%, indicating that our industry has made progress in many aspects and is very vital. Of course, the situation we are facing is also very serious.
After listening to today's meeting, I am thinking about it. What should we do next? In the morning, Secretary-General Wang conveyed the requirements of the General Assembly in two directions: one is innovation and the other is service. This service is to serve the community. When it comes to innovation, specifically to our industry, which products should be innovative and which products should be updated? Which products are restricted and cannot be used? These issues should be discussed well. I want to make a few comments:

First, from the bucking to the abrasive to the adhesive to the filler, each target has not kept up, and now it is still talking about things.
From the perspective of the substrate, cloth, paper, fiber, film, rubber, etc. are very good products, but one of the shortcomings is that there is a lot of commonality, and the pertinence is not enough, including the two kinds of abrasives introduced by the two companies in the afternoon. Zirconium corundum and ceramic abrasives, which materials are they targeting? The situation of grinding, etc., is not targeted. If it is not targeted, the next step will not be promoted. What is the processing precision of your product, what is the processing object, is titanium alloy, stainless steel 304? Is cast iron, ball-milled cast iron 50, 40, high-strength aluminum alloy? What are the advantages of processing this material, etc., these must have no specificity. This includes problems with cloth, strong grinding and other grinding. Therefore, our entire industry has not kept up with the specificity from buckling to abrasives to adhesives to fillers. Now we are still talking about things in general.

Second, raw material companies must go to the end user to verify their products.
Raw material companies are generally accustomed to verifying their products in the product factory, but I want to tell you that the problems that need to be solved at the end user site are much more difficult and harder than what you can think of in the enterprise. So you have to follow the product company to the end user to understand the situation and see if your product is best used by the end user, so as to test your end users. Third, we don't have a lot of things in the market, and some companies stop production because of backward products.
We know that many of the things that users are using now need to be updated, but we also have many companies that have stopped production due to problems such as grinding efficiency, cost of the company and environmental protection. Things made with ordinary abrasives and ordinary abrasive tools are parked there, and the dust is too large. So now we need a very large amount of things on the market, and we are still staring at your next customer. The end users have a lot of specialized, specialized and targeted work that requires us to do a lot. Go and do it. For example, abrasives, we have done a lot of types: plastic abrasives, sintered abrasives, stacked abrasives, composite abrasives, mixed abrasives, etc., but for the application of various abrasives, we have not really researched the home for different materials. For example, zirconium alloys are basically ground without ordinary abrasives, and CBN is not used. It must be ground with special abrasives. Nowadays, there is a lot of demand in the country, such as the processing of titanium alloy into mirrored plates, which is in great demand. On the military side, Russia's nuclear submarine shells are all made of titanium alloy. The aluminum alloy used in the three-fold supersonic aircraft made by Xi'an Aircraft Manufacturing Plant is now required to make five times the speed of sound. Titanium alloy must also be used. The shell is completely scattered when flying to a certain extent, and a precision-polished titanium alloy must be used.
In terms of composite abrasives, our targeting is too much. In terms of adhesives, the demand for non-toxic and environmentally friendly adhesives is very large. The adhesives of phenolic, formaldehyde and phenol that we currently use are highly toxic, and the damage to the human body and the environment is also great. Or because one of the indicators of the adhesive does not meet the standard, it will affect many products can not be produced. We can't always turn around phenolic and oxygen. Many resins need to be modified to improve their performance and improve their targeting.

Fourth, we must strengthen basic research and use data to express your products.
We have studied too little for auxiliary materials. The cryolite used in the grinding industry originally used sodium salt and sodium fluoroaluminate. In the past few years, potassium fluoroaluminate has been used. They all say good but don't know where it is. Some interested companies have done cutting experiments on various materials and finally reached a conclusion. Therefore, for all kinds of materials, lubrication, heat conduction, heat absorption, antistatic, etc., they must have data on the final application effect, otherwise the data from the company is always half; your home abrasives are obvious What is the micro-hardness and particle shape? Can't say it. Therefore, companies must do a good job in this area. In addition, our testing equipment is much worse than the international standard, and the detected things can not be used. The work of internationalization and generalization of testing standards has to keep up. The export volume of coated abrasives in China has reached 39%, which is very large. In the event that any product has a problem, it is necessary to go to court, and the standard is not uniform, which will cause a lot of trouble. Therefore, the input of testing equipment and the uniform refinement of standards are a good lesson to be filled.

5. About environmental issues. It is hoped that all enterprises will invest in governance, and the abrasive enterprises will be too dusty; the original cloth will use too much water; the adhesive companies need not say more, and every enterprise has environmental problems.
Finally, we must consider intelligent digital manufacturing. Many things are not done manually now. Many enterprises, especially large enterprises, use a large number of intelligent devices, especially control systems, to digitize information. I hope that our company will give special consideration to this issue when it comes to upgrading. We will focus on the upgrading of products and product development. On this basis, we will have a way out of environmental protection and automation of equipment. Of course, the most important thing is that a company must have innovative products, so that it has a foothold.
